For the 2026 school year, there are 3 public preschools serving 1,605 students in Harrisburg City School District. This district's average pre testing ranking is 1/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public pre schools in Pennsylvania.
Public Preschools in Harrisburg City School District have an average math proficiency score of 5% (versus the Pennsylvania public pre school average of 28%), and reading proficiency score of 10% (versus the 38%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 97%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Pennsylvania public preschool average of 56% (majority Black and Hispanic).

District Rank
Harrisburg City School District, which is ranked within the bottom 50% of all 677 school districts in Pennsylvania (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2022-2023 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 62% has decreased from 65%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$24,058 is higher than the state median of $23,724.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$23,230 is higher than the state median of $23,146.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
